Setting up an Amazon seller account may look simple on the surface, but many UK sellers quickly realise how confusing and time-consuming the process can be. From choosing the right account type to VAT registration, identity verification, and compliance with Amazon UK policies, one small mistake can delay your launch or even lead to account rejection.
This is where a professional Amazon account setup service becomes essential especially for sellers in London and across the UK who want to start strong and avoid costly errors.
In this guide, we’ll explain why using an Amazon seller account setup service in London is the smartest move for new and growing sellers, what’s involved in the setup process, and how expert support can help you launch with confidence.
Why Amazon Seller Account Setup Is Challenging for UK Sellers
Amazon has strict onboarding requirements for UK sellers. While the platform is global, the UK marketplace has its own tax, compliance, and verification rules that often confuse first-time sellers.
Common challenges include:
- Choosing between Individual vs Professional seller accounts
- Understanding Amazon UK VAT requirements
- Business verification and identity checks
- Address and document mismatches
- Incorrect marketplace selection (UK vs EU)
- Account suspension during verification
Many sellers in London attempt DIY setups, only to face delays or rejections that slow down their business before it even starts.
What Is an Amazon Account Setup Service?
An Amazon account setup service is a done-for-you solution where Amazon experts handle the complete seller account registration process on your behalf.
Instead of guessing your way through Amazon’s forms and policies, you get professional guidance that ensures:
- Correct account type selection
- Smooth verification approval
- Compliance with Amazon UK rules
- Faster go-live time
- Zero setup stress
For businesses in London, this service is especially valuable when time, accuracy, and long-term account health matter.
Amazon Seller Account Setup Service in London: What’s Included
A professional Amazon seller account setup service in London typically covers every critical step needed to launch successfully on Amazon UK.
1. Seller Account Consultation
Before setup begins, experts analyse your business model private label, wholesale, or D2C and recommend the best account structure for your goals.
2. Account Registration & Configuration
Your seller account is created correctly with:
- Proper marketplace selection (Amazon UK)
- Correct business and contact details
- Professional seller plan setup
3. Identity & Document Verification
Amazon verification is one of the most common failure points. Experts ensure:
- Documents meet Amazon’s requirements
- No mismatches in address or business details
- Smooth approval without repeated rejections
4. VAT & Tax Guidance
UK VAT compliance is critical. A reliable amazon seller account setup service helps you understand:
- Whether VAT registration is required
- How VAT applies to Amazon FBA and FBM sellers
- Best practices for tax readiness
5. Seller Central Dashboard Setup
Your Seller Central account is configured properly so you’re ready for:
- Product listings
- Fulfilment settings
- Payments and deposits
- Brand tools (where applicable)
Why Choose a London-Based Amazon Seller Account Setup Service?
Working with a local UK agency offers clear advantages compared to generic global providers.
UK & London Market Expertise
A London-based team understands:
- Amazon.co.uk policies
- UK business regulations
- Local seller challenges
Clear Communication & Accountability
You get direct communication, clear timelines, and expert support aligned with UK business hours.
Long-Term Amazon Growth Support
A good setup service doesn’t just stop at registration it sets the foundation for:
- Amazon SEO
- Product listings
- PPC advertising
- Storefront creation
Who Needs an Amazon Seller Account Setup Service?
This service is ideal for:
- New Amazon sellers launching in the UK
- London-based startups entering eCommerce
- D2C brands expanding to Amazon
- Business owners who want a done-for-you solution
- Sellers who faced previous account rejection
If you’re serious about building a profitable Amazon business, starting with a professional setup makes a real difference.
Benefits of Using a Professional Amazon Account Setup Service
Here’s what UK sellers gain by using expert support:
- Faster account approval
- Reduced risk of suspension
- Correct compliance from day one
- Time savings for business owners
- Strong foundation for scaling
Instead of troubleshooting problems later, you launch with clarity and confidence.
Why Creative Circuit Is Trusted for Amazon Seller Account Setup in London
Creative Circuit is a UK-based Amazon growth agency that specialises in helping sellers launch and scale successfully on Amazon.
What sets Creative Circuit apart:
- Deep expertise in Amazon UK & London market
- End-to-end Amazon services under one roof
- Data-driven, ROI-first approach
- Clear, transparent process
- Seller-focused, non-salesy guidance
Beyond account setup, Creative Circuit supports sellers with listings, Amazon SEO, A+ Content, PPC management, and full Amazon growth strategies making them a long-term partner, not just a setup provider.
Start Your Amazon Journey the Right Way
Amazon is highly competitive, especially in the UK marketplace. A poorly set up account can lead to delays, lost opportunities, or compliance issues that hurt your business before it begins.
Using a professional Amazon account setup service especially an experienced Amazon seller account setup service in London ensures your business starts strong, compliant, and ready to scale.
If you want to sell on Amazon UK without confusion, delays, or costly mistakes, expert support is the smartest first step.